It's supposed to exist outside tme axis so that it isnt affected, but now it was directly affected. I have a bit of free time now, so let's see. Mashu wasn't revived because she didn't really die. The thing about Mashu is that she should've died ages ago, as her life force was extinguished and she was only able to continue existing due to the fusion with Galahad, whose mana substited her life force. The more she used Galahad's power, the more she used the mana that was literally keeping her alive. Galahad was quite literally her resuscitation device. In the final singularity she chose to use her NP to block Solomon's NP to protect the MC, which caused all of her mana; life force, to be drained. What Good Guy Primate Murder did was transfer all of the mana it accumulated over time to substitute Galahad's mana, essentially giving her enough for her body and soul to continue living as much as a normal human body and soul can. As I said before in that anime thread, apparently alternate universes have certain criteria to be allowed to exist by Akasha. An alternative universe where no chance of prosper can ever occur is a possibility that will always be rejected by Akasha. So, in short, there really isn't an infinite amount of possible worlds. A world like Camelot's singularity would never be allowed by Akasha as CCO would ensure true peace via Rhongomyniad AKA using a conceptual power to eventually end everything. What Solomon did was use his magecraft to enforce a certain reality on Akasha, very similar to how a Marble Phantasm can be enforced on Akasha and through Akasha, to allow these worlds to exist, while still counting as deviations and not contradiction to Akasha, and then use the almost infinite supply of mana in a holy grail to sustain it. Therefore, once the grail was secured in a singularity, that world ceased to exist. And because this world was originally rejected by Akasha, absolutely none of its remnants are allowed to exist, and that includes the spirits that entered the Throne as a result. On that point, only a normally occurring world can have an entry into the Akasha-controlled Throne. It's not that the throne can't be affected because it's outside time and space, it's that it's outside time and space because it's only under the influence of the root, literally the source and end of every single thing, including the Throne. Some parts of this were explicitly stated in GO and some were heavily hinted at in Extella and its material. |

Nasu blog 2016/12/26 : Human Foundation Restored >『Fate/Grand Order』第一部、多くのプレイヤーの戦いによってめでたく完結となりました。 >This is the end of Fate/Grand Order PART ONE Story for the final chapter remained the same as in the initial planning phase; It was always going to be about Goetia and Roman and Mashu and Fou(r). Chapter 7's script was done in the first week of October while the final chapter was done in the last, but November was spent putting together Christmas and 7 so they only had one month to actually make the final chapter. Christmas was in November because Nasu wanted the final chapter to come immediately after 7, even it was dumb from a business POV. They prioritised story over Christmas. Yeah confirmed nothing for the rest of the year (he says to go collect EXP or something) He recommends reading the boss materials because they might be relevant. The final chapter's scenes with the servants showing up: Chapters 2 and 4 were done by Sakurai, 3 and 5 by Higashide. He told them to keep it at 10 kb of text, 15 at most for each chapter with 25 at most for two, but they both gave him 20 kb per chapter. He complained but they pointed out that he said the chapter would be 40 kb then wrote 120 kb. There is a "yearly item supply", a sort of "item budget" thing, inside the game, which determines drops. They loosened this in the Time Temple so that you can just get all the shit you want. He actually fucking says "just like assets in real life" >現実の資産同様 >There is a "yearly item supply", a sort of "item budget" thing, inside the game, which determines drops. (Wait what. Drops are artificially limited? They're not by chance?) He says that while you may think that Ars Armadillo Salmonella may instakill your entire front line, but if you use your experience up to this point there are ways to get past it. "This is the last battle, don't skimp on the command spells!" He praises Sugita's performance and how he uses different voices for different demons. He especially likes Goetia who's filled with rage, but this is not the sort of anger that comes from hate but is screaming "why". He now has Andromalius speaking in his head whenever he buys stuff off Amazon ("Why seek more!?" "Why hoard!?" and not mentioned on the blog but "Dispose of everything unneeded!" is presumably relevant too) Most of the demons only got emotions at the very end, but Flauros got his emotions very early on. That's why he was able to troll Chaldea while the other demons were mostly machine-like. That's also why Flauros never excepted their loss, and didn't give up, till the very end (posted this before but he's the last demon to die). He was also the one demon that empathised with Mashu. Yamanaka Kotetsu was commissioned to do the demons after he did the main visual for the UBW movie. The designs were perfect so they got him to do Tiamat. Tiamat is supposed to be the "ultimate form of the Sakura-type character". There are also rough cuts of a little girl version of the Femme Fatalle, wait for chapter 7's Material. The reason why Tiamat has 11 Lahums stronger than demons is because they're her equivalent of the demons, but while Goetia has 72 she only has 11 so quality over quantity. "Thanks, Yamanaka-san! Now all we need to do is wait for Holmes to get in!" About the OP, Shikisai: When making the song they explained how the story would end to Sakamoto, and she made the song based on the game's themes. Also, Nasu wrote the plot to FGO while listening to Sakamoto's song Scrap. He thinks Roman's ten years is close to what's depicted in Scrap and actually told Takeuchi that he wanted to use it as FGO's OP, and Takeuchi is the one who said they might as well get her to make an original song.
